Mutations, spontaneous changes in DNA, may seem like they're always negative, but while they do cause a number of forms of disease they are also responsible for all variation in evolution, beneficial, neutral, and harmful. UW-Madison Genetics Program graduate students Kevin and Katharine discuss what mutations are, and how they affect evolution and people’s lives.
